Welcome to CIS 109!
You will find the syllabus to the course in the Handouts section below (General Information section).
The assignment schedule is not attached to the syllabus. It is in a separate  document in the same section of the Handouts.
Many handouts are pdf files. You must have a pdf file reader to open them. To download Adobe Acrobat Reader, click here.
  • Alice Unit

    You will find here all material for the Alice unit of study.
    Name Description Status Source
    Practice for Alice test-solution Required Alice Practice test-sp 11-solrev.pdf Edit Practice for Alice test-solution Delete Practice for Alice test-solution
    Practice test-Alice unit Required Alice Practice test-sp 11v2.pdf Edit Practice test-Alice unit Delete Practice test-Alice unit
    Alice Exercsie 18 solution (Joey Fence and tree) Required KangorooCode.html Edit Alice Exercsie 18 solution (Joey Fence and tree) Delete Alice Exercsie 18 solution (Joey Fence and tree)
    Setting up Worlds Required SettingUpWorlds.ppt Edit Setting up Worlds Delete Setting up Worlds
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
  • Alice Worlds

    In tis section you will find all the Worlds needed for your Alice class work or exercises.
    Name Description Status Source
    Sound files
    This zipped folder contains the sound files used in the World in sections 7 and 8 of Programming with Alice. Use Firefox instead of Internet Explorer when trying to download  this zipped folder. If you are still not  able to work with zipped folders on school computers, the files are also on the Hdrive (H>Mathematics and Computing>Schep>CIS 109-CD>Alice) in a non-zipped format. 
    Required Sound files.zip Edit Sound files Delete Sound files
    Snowwoman and penguin -sect 2
    Complete World after section 2
    Required penguinAndSnowwoman-sect2.a2w Edit Snowwoman and penguin -sect 2 Delete Snowwoman and penguin -sect 2
    AliceExercise6
    World for exercise 6
    Required AliceExercise6.a2w Edit AliceExercise6 Delete AliceExercise6
    WizardHockeyGame world
    World for exercise 7 to 10
    Required WizardHockeyGame.a2w Edit WizardHockeyGame world Delete WizardHockeyGame world
    JoeyFenceAndTree
    World for exercise 18
    Required JoeyFenceAndTree.a2w Edit JoeyFenceAndTree Delete JoeyFenceAndTree
    SnowwomanAndPenguin-sect 5
    SnowwomanAndPenguin World at end of section 5
    Required penguinAndSnowwoman-sect5.a2w Edit SnowwomanAndPenguin-sect 5 Delete SnowwomanAndPenguin-sect 5
    Interactive World
    World for Alice section 7
    Required InteractiveInstrumentInitial.a2w Edit Interactive World Delete Interactive World
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
  • Representing Data

    Name Description Status Source
    GraphicExplorer
    This zipped folder contains a program called GraphicExplorer and a folder of pictures. Download the folder to the computer. Then extract the files: navigate to where the folder is located, right-click on it, and select Extract all. Follow the instructions of the dialog box.
    A small demo of the program is on the tutorial/demo portlet. 
    Required GraphicExplorer.zip Edit GraphicExplorer Delete GraphicExplorer
    Review for test on Data Representation Required CIS 109 Review for test-DataRep.pdf Edit Review for test on Data Representation Delete Review for test on Data Representation
    Lab-IntroToImages-part1 Required Lab-IntroToImages-part 1.pdf Edit Lab-IntroToImages-part1 Delete Lab-IntroToImages-part1
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
  • Networks

    Name Description Status Source
    Notes on networks and Graph theory Required Networks v2.pdf Edit Notes on networks and Graph theory Delete Notes on networks and Graph theory
    Review for Network Test
    The test on network is Thursday, February 10. The problems in this review and the homework exercises are good preparation for the test. It will be a short  test (about 30 min.)
    Solutions to the review will be posted on Wednesday at 11:55PM. It is very recommended to complete the problems BEFORE viewing the solutions. 
    Required CIS 109 Review for Network Test.pdf Edit Review for Network Test Delete Review for Network Test
    Review for network test-solutions Required CIS 109 Review for Network Test-solution.pdf Edit Review for network test-solutions Delete Review for network test-solutions
    Network Presentation Required NETWORKS and GRAPHS.pptx Edit Network Presentation Delete Network Presentation
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
  • Women in Computing

    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
Edit the following settings for all selected Resources.
Select a start and end date and time
Start: Start:
End: End:
You are not authorized to use this portlet; It is only available to users in certain roles within the portal.
You have no incoming announcements.
  • Ungrouped

    Required
    GraphicExplorer2_demo.pdf
    Required
    ChangePicture_demo.swf
    This pdf file requires Adobe reader 9 ( available in our lab and in the math lab). You can download it for free be clicking here.
    Required
    Introduction to Audacity.pdf
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
Edit the following settings for all selected Resources.
Select a start and end date and time
Start: Start:
End: End:
  • Computing Careers

    Name Description Status Source
    NCWIT resource page
    Resources page of the Nationnal Center for Women and Information Technology
    This page has many links to find information about careers, women in IT, the "real life" of IT people, etc. 
    Required www.ncwit.org Edit NCWIT resource page Delete NCWIT resource page
    ACM Computing careers
    Computing careers website form the largest international computer science organization, the Association for Computing Machinery.
    Required computingcareers.acm.org Edit ACM Computing careers Delete ACM Computing careers
    Computing carreer site
    Sloan Career Corner Stone Center, another site to get information about computing careers
    Required www.careercornerstone.org Edit Computing carreer site Delete Computing carreer site
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
  • Women in computing

    Name Description Status Source
    Women Entrepreneurs in IT
    Interviews of successful women entrpreneurs in IT companies, large and small, even non-profit.
    Required www.ncwit.org Edit Women Entrepreneurs in IT Delete Women Entrepreneurs in IT
    IBM WIT external links page
    IBM Women in Technology external links page. Provide links to a number of of website concerning women and technology.
    Required www-03.ibm.com Edit IBM WIT external links page Delete IBM WIT external links page
    IBM WIT Persona page
    Links to two pages full of interviews and portraits of women who made significant contributions at IBM.
    Required www-03.ibm.com Edit IBM WIT Persona page Delete IBM WIT Persona page
    Grace Hopper Celebration Awards Winner
    Short portraits of the awards winner of the 2009 Grace Hopper Celebration of Women in Computing.
    Required gracehopper.org Edit Grace Hopper Celebration Awards Winner Delete Grace Hopper Celebration Awards Winner
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
  • Ungrouped

    Name Description Status Source
    Pair-programming
    Video introduction to pair-programming
    Required agile.csc.ncsu.edu Edit Pair-programming Delete Pair-programming
    While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
While focused on a reorder icon, press the Enter key or spacebar to "select" the icon. While a reorder icon is selected, pressing the up and down arrows will change the order of the selected item within the list. Pressing Enter key or spacebar again will drop the selected item at that location in the list.
Edit the following settings for all selected Resources.
Select a start and end date and time
Start: Start:
End: End: